Rembrandt

Rembrandt - Portrait of Catrina Hooghsaet

A special loan of Rembrandt van Rijn’s (1606-1669) Portrait of Catrina Hooghsaet from Penrhyn Castle will be on show at National Museum Cardiff alongside original etchings and Netherlandish portraits from National Museum Wales’s own collection.
National Museum Cardiff (04 Nov 09 - 21 Mar 10)



Picasso: Still Life with Poron

Picasso - Still Life with Poron

A new, free display, bringing together mid 20th century still life paintings, including Pablo Picasso’s striking Still Life with Poron (1948) - the first oil painting by the artist to enter a Welsh public collection.
National Museum Cardiff (10 Nov 09 - 30 Jun 10)

Santu Mofokeng

Santu Mofokeng

Santu Mofokeng is one of South Africa’s leading photographers. He began his career as a street photographer in Soweto and through the 1980’s worked on the documentary coverage of the anti-Apartheid struggle.
Canolfan y Celfyddydau Aberystwyth Arts Centre (23 Jan 10 - 20 Mar 10)

Italian Memories in Wales

Italian Memories in Wales

Over the last year ACLI-ENAIP has been recording the life stories and collecting photographs of 55 Italians, 16 of second generation and 39 of first generation who emigrated to Wales after the Second World War.
St Fagans:National History Museum (30 Jan 10 - 03 May 10)
